actinia-cloudevent-plugin

This is a plugin for actinia-core which translates cloudevents into a process definition for actinia-core and runs as standalone app.

Installation and Setup

Use docker-compose for installation:

docker compose -f docker/docker-compose.yml build
docker compose -f docker/docker-compose.yml up -d

DEV setup with vscode

  1. Start actinia-core locally via local dev-setup as described in the actinia-docker repository
  2. Have this repository open locally with vscode and press F5. After a few seconds, a browser window should be openend, pointing to an endpoint (showing 405 Method Not Allowed as this plugin has only HTTP POST endpoints so far).

Alternatively, configure actinia-core to run jobs via actinia-worker. In the actinia-core dev-setup, use the per_job queue in actinia-docker/actinia-dev/actinia.cfg:

[QUEUE]
# queue_type = local

[QUEUE]
queue_type = per_job
kvdb_queue_server_url = valkey
kvdb_queue_server_password = pass
worker_queue_prefix = job_queue

And restart the vscode debugger. This way, a job is registered in the valkey DB, but not directly started.

Requesting endpoint

Note: Assuming cloudevent-plugin is running as described in previous setup.

You can test the plugin and request the / endpoint, e.g. with:

JSON=tests/examples/cloudevent_example.json
curl -X POST -H 'Content-Type: application/json' --data @$JSON localhost:3003/

Or test with per_job queue

JSON=tests/examples/cloudevent_example.json
curl -X POST -H 'Content-Type: application/json' --data @$JSON localhost:3003/
# Get the actinia job queue name from the response
QUEUE_NAME=job_queue_resource_id-d4d9be86-5938-47ff-9c6d-7c79964862c0

docker run --rm --network actinia-docker_actinia-dev \
  -v $HOME/actinia/grassdb:/actinia_core/grassdb \
  -v $HOME/actinia/grassdb_user:/actinia_core/userdata \
  --entrypoint actinia-worker actiniacore -q $QUEUE_NAME

Exemplary returned cloudevent: tests/examples/cloudevent_example_return.json

Running tests

You can run the tests in the actinia test docker. These are the same steps which the github workflow is executing.

docker compose -f docker/docker-compose.yml up -d --build
sleep 10 && \
    docker logs docker-actinia-cloudevent-1 && echo && \
    docker logs docker-actinia-core-1 && echo && \
    docker logs docker-event-receiver-server-1
docker exec -t docker-actinia-cloudevent-1 make integrationtest
docker compose -f docker/docker-compose.yml down
